• Home
  • Contact Info
  • Whatsapp AI
  • Ask AI
  • Map
  • Images
  • Profile
  • Suggest edits
  •  
  • Privacy

Logo

Villa Romero Boracay
  1. Logo

Albums

All (1) Logo (1)
logo

Villa Romero Boracay

Resorts

Station 3, Manoc Manoc, Boracay Island, Malay 5608, Philippines
Call
Call 63 36 288 44**

Sections

  • Home
  • Contact Info
  • Whatsapp AI
  • Ask AI
  • Map
  • Images
  • Profile
  • Share
  • Copied
Suggest edits